Media Create Charts: Fire Emblem Fates is Top Selling Game in Japan

New Nintendo 3DS is top selling platform followed by PS4 this week.

Fire Emblem Fates

The popularity of Fire Emblem in Japan shouldn’t be underestimated – the newest game in the series for Nintendo 3DS, Fire Emblem Fates is still the top-selling title in Japan according to this week’s Media Create charts. It sold 54,986 units for a lifetime total of 315,571 units.

Next up was Rhythm Heaven: The Best Plus on 3DS which sold 34,467 units this past week while averaging 301,193 units over its lifetime. Nintendo’s Splatoon has also been doing fairly well in Japan with 34,135 units sold and 382,175 units in its lifetime. It was followed by Persona 4: Dancing All Night on the Vita which sold 13,028 units this week (107,064 units over its lifetime) and Minecraft: PS Vita Edition which sold 11,941 units (lifetime of 232,530 units).

And even though the PS Vita out-sold the New Nintendo 3DS XL last week, the latter rose to the challenge and beat it this week. The New 3DS XL sold 19,475 units while the Vita only managed 14,067 units. The PS4 was the second best-selling console in Japan for this week with 18,171 units sold while the Wii U hung in there with 12,781 units sold.
